In the match between England and New Zealand, in the manner in which New Zealand batsman Henry Nicholls got out on Thursday, hardly any batsman in the history of cricket would have been out like this.
Everyone was surprised to see the manner of getting out like this.
On the first day of the third test match of the series against England, New Zealand lost their 5 wickets till the score of 123 runs.
Henry Nicholls returned to the pavilion as the team's 5th wicket.
Actually Jack Leach was bowling in the 56th over in the match.
Henry Nicholls of New Zealand was batting in front, when he played a shot, the ball hit the non-striker's end and hit the bat of Daryl Mitchell.
He also tried to escape but the ball after hitting Mitchell's bat went straight into the hands of Liege standing in mid-off.

In this way, Nicholas got out in a very strange way after scoring 19 runs.
If we talk about the match, so far in this third test match, New Zealand have won the toss and decided to bat first.
Before the match was stopped due to rain, New Zealand scored 187 runs for the loss of 5 wickets after 74 overs of play.
